You will need: three different
clean trash items from home (do not bring in food wastes)
Your teacher will provide five bags
labeled: glass, paper, aluminum, plastic, pure trash.
Follow the steps below to discover how to sort
trash for recycling:
1. Place each of the items that you brought
from home in the correct container.
2. When all items have been sorted, count
the number of items in each container.
3. Using Microsoft Excel or another graphing
program, create a chart to show your results.
4. Graph your results.
5. Find the mass of each container to determine
which of the five groups makes up the heaviest portion of our trash.
6. Using Microsoft Excel or another graphing
program, create a chart to explain your results.
7. Graph your results.
